  Abstract


Diabetes mellitus is a chronic metabolic disorder caused by carbohydrate, fat, and protein metabolism problems. Genetic predispositions and environmental influences contribute to the disease, presenting significant challenges to patients' health. There are two types of diabetes, Type I and Type II. Both lead to elevated blood glucose levels (hyperglycemia). Several complications are associated with persistent hyperglycemia, including microvascular problems affecting the eye, kidneys, and nerves, as well as macrovascular problems like accelerated artery hardening, which increases heart disease, stroke, and peripheral artery disease risks. It is essential to focus on the prevention and management of diabetes-related complications in order to mitigate their impact on micro and macrovascular health. It is important to consider alternative treatment options as these medications can pose undesirable side effects. Medication, dietary adjustments, and regular exercise are all part of comprehensive diabetes management. Our study was aimed of the present study is to explore the anti-oxidant and anti-diabetic activity in the leaves of Stachytarpheta urticifolia. A comprehensive study was conducted to examine Stachytarphata urticifolia, a traditional botanical remedy, for its phytochemical composition, antioxidant potential, and effectiveness against diabetes. In this study, Stachytarphata urticifolia was found to exhibit significant diabetic-fighting and anti-oxidant properties. In addition to phenolic compounds, flavonoids, alkaloids, and terpenoids, Stachytarphata urticifolia contains hundreds of bioactive compounds. Phytochemicals such as these, which possess anti-oxidant and anti-diabetic properties, are considered to be promising therapeutic choices for humans who are suffering from diabetes or metabolic disorders. Stachytarphata urticifolia has shown remarkable antioxidant activity over the past few decades, which has been demonstrated to be helpful in preventing oxidative damage and preventing the onset of chronic diseases like diabetes by battling free radicals and combating oxidative stress. The in vitro studies of S. urticifolia were conducted in order to evaluate its anti-diabetic potential. There have been studies conducted in vitro that examined key enzymes associated with carbohydrate metabolism in an attempt to determine whether Stachytarphata urticifolia inhibits carbohydrate digestion and absorption by inducing moderate inhibitory effects on amylase, glucose oxidase, and glucose uptake. There was no doubt that S. urticifolia is capable of reducing complications associated with diabetes and these findings suggest that it may be useful for patients with diabetes who need to mitigate these complications. As part of this study, we examined S. urticifolia, a well-known traditional plant, for its phytochemical composition and potential anti-oxidant and anti-diabetic effects. The anti-oxidant potential of S. urticifolia and its moderate anti-diabetic activity were also found in our study. Based on the results of this study, S. urticifolia might be of benefit to diabetic patients as a therapeutic agent.
